Although the T H2 DV/T H2 OS is designed to operate with minimal sound,
TAKAGI does not recommend installing the unit on a wall adjacent to a
bedroom, or a room that is intended for quiet study or meditation, etc.
x
Locate your heater close to a drain where water leakage will not do damage to
surrounding areas. As with any water heating appliance, the potential for
leakage at some time in the life of the product does exist. Takagi will not be
responsible for any water damage that may occur. If you install a drain pan
under the unit, ensure that it will not restrict the combustion air flow.
WARNING
x
T H2 DV/T H2 OS are high efficiency products that create condensation. A
condensation drain tube must be installed with the T H2 DV/T H2 OS to
discharge condensate into a drain outlet. For more information, refer to p. 20.

Installation and service must be performed by a qualified installer (for
example, a licensed plumber or gas fitter), otherwise the warranty by Takagi
will be void.
The installer (licensed professional) is responsible for the correct installation
of your T H2 DV/T H2 OS Water Heater and for compliance with all national,
state/provincial, and local codes.
Only potable water or potable water / glycol mixtures can be used with this
water heater. Do not introduce pool or spa water, or any chemically
treated water into the water heater.
Water hardness levels must not exceed 7 grains per gallon (120 ppm) for
single family domestic applications or more than 4 grains per gallon (70
ppm) for all other types of applications. Water hardness leads to scale
formation and may affect/damage the water heater. Hard water scaling
must be avoided or controlled by proper water treatment.
Water pH levels must be between 6.5 and 8.5
Well water must be treated.
Make sure your unit will have enough combustion air and proper
ventilation.
Keep the area around your T H2 DV clean. When dust collects on the flame
sensor, the water heater will shut down on errors.
Locate unit for easy access for service and maintenance.
A drain pan, or other means of protection against water damage, is
required to be installed under the water heater in case of leaks.
